Feelings:
I was highly apprehensive about the fact that she failed to follow the basic nursing
protocol. However, I was extremely scared to rectify her faulty procedure, fearing she may
feel hurt or even subjected to insult. Under the guidance of my supervisor, I was supposed to
learn basic ethics and health protocol. However, I was confused that she herself failed to stick
to the rules. I was alarmed, and expected the doctor to wash her hands. Later, I decided to
speak to my mentor about the same incident. Understanding my concern, I thought she would
suggest me to directlytalk to the physician about it, but out of fear, I could not make it to her.
